Output eb229f028da59013247c6cc3a7ec2d681ec95753c9bf553804ceb282d0a9af43:18

value
13800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ae55da42124d71ed9408e2475e2e444c9758c377 OP_EQUAL
address
A8L55uhYGQmQwkeJn4ZC64Qr6iEHFcSsAk
transaction
eb229f028da59013247c6cc3a7ec2d681ec95753c9bf553804ceb282d0a9af43